Output 134876316ea7838149d1d615c3dd976b8451458649b875f42c107f2cb1dd6c79:3

value
318203697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aaf3cf1bedc8709fe9b09e1e7944bbd83b77bef OP_EQUAL
address
32fWcDVVQwQRjMQo2umsHBReejaBqa448V
transaction
134876316ea7838149d1d615c3dd976b8451458649b875f42c107f2cb1dd6c79
spent
true